Featuring three of Balanchine's biggest and boldest, Western Symphony gets the program started with its familiar melodies and old west charm before turning the reins over to Symphony in Three Movements, a thrilling leotard ballet with an electric Stravinsky score. Symphony in C is a dazzling end to an impressive program, closing with its ballerinas spinning and soaring in glittering Swarovski tutus.

SYMPHONIC BALANCHINE

  • Western Symphony

    • Music by: Traditional American melodies orchestrated by Hershy Kay
    • Choreography by: George Balanchine

    Western Symphony is a rodeo of frisky fillies and lonesome cowpokes with a rousing, non-stop finale that brings the curtain down.

  • Symphony in Three Movements

    • Music by: Igor Stravinsky
    • Choreography by: George Balanchine

    Bold and breathtakingly jet-propelled, Symphony in Three Movements is a kinetic tour de force, striking for its simplicity and power.

  • Symphony in C

    • Music by: Georges Bizet
    • Choreography by: George Balanchine*

    Featuring new costumes created in collaboration with Swarovski, this classical masterpiece dazzles audiences with its crystalline luminosity, a cast of over 50 dancers, and a spectacular finale.
